It seems that fans can’t get enough Grand Theft Auto, and now everyone can gear up for Grand Theft Auto: Vice City Stories for the PSP.

Vice City Stories is a prequel to Vice City and takes place in 1984. Players will take control of Vic Vance, Lance Vance’s brother. You may remember Vic dying in the opening scene of Vice City, so there’s going to be a bit of Oedipal irony involved when playing Vice City Stories.

The premise is simple enough: Vic is out on the streets and must build an empire or be crushed. A majority of the gameplay will be similar to the previous games, with Rockstar promising incremental adjustments to the graphics and gameplay.

One major overhaul, however, is the empire building. Vic can start a number of businesses, ranging from extortion to prostitution. He can also attack and be attacked by rival gangs, bringing the flavour of Grand Theft Auto 2 to the game. The ultimate goal is, obviously, to grow your own crime empire while crushing those of your enemies.

With improved graphics and sound, adjustments to control, and some decent improvements to the gameplay to keep things fresh, Grand Theft Auto: Vice City Stories is shaping up to be another quality addition to the series that should satiate fans until GTA IV arrives.
